Scope
This standard specifies the symbol and category classification, size, shape and weight, technical requirements, test methods, inspection rules, packaging, signs and quality certificates of pure iron as raw material. This standard applies to electrothermal alloys, precision alloys (including soft magnetic materials, hard magnetic materials, elastic alloys, expansion alloys, etc.), low-carbon stainless steel, ultra-low-carbon stainless steel and powder metallurgy, etc. Steel bars and hot-rolled wire rods.
